- Prepare beforehand: Before you dial, gather all the necessary information related to your query. This might include your account number, policy details, or any previous communication you've had with Reliance Finance. Having this information readily available will help the customer service representative assist you more efficiently.
- Be clear and concise: Clearly state the purpose of your call at the beginning. This helps the representative understand your issue and direct you to the appropriate resources. Avoid rambling or providing unnecessary details, as this can prolong the call and make it more difficult for the representative to understand your needs.
- Be polite and patient: Customer service representatives are there to help you, but they're also dealing with numerous calls throughout the day. Treat them with respect and be patient while they work to resolve your issue. Getting angry or frustrated will not expedite the process and may even hinder their ability to assist you.
- Take notes: During the call, jot down important information such as the representative's name, any reference numbers, and the steps you need to take to resolve your issue. This will help you keep track of the conversation and follow up on any outstanding items.
- Confirm understanding: Before ending the call, summarize the key points and confirm that you and the representative are on the same page. This ensures that there are no misunderstandings and that you have a clear plan of action. If anything is unclear, don't hesitate to ask for clarification.

Finding the Correct Reliance Finance Contact Number
Okay, let's get down to business. Finding the right Reliance Finance contact number isn't as hard as you might think. Here are some easy ways to track it down:
1. Official Website
Your first stop should always be the official Reliance Finance website. Most companies, including Reliance Finance, have a dedicated "Contact Us" or "Support" page. This page usually lists various contact numbers for different departments such as customer service, loan inquiries, investment support, and more.
Navigating the website is usually straightforward. Look for a header or footer link that says "Contact," "Support," or "Help." Once you're on the contact page, you'll typically find a list of phone numbers, email addresses, and sometimes even a live chat option. The key is to identify the department that best fits your needs. For instance, if you have questions about a specific loan product, look for the contact number listed under "Loan Inquiries" or a similar category. If you can't find a specific number for your particular issue, the general customer service number is always a good starting point. They can redirect you to the appropriate department if needed.
The Reliance Finance website might also offer a FAQ (Frequently Asked Questions) section. Before reaching out, it’s worth checking the FAQ to see if your question has already been answered. This can save you time and effort. Additionally, some websites provide a contact form that you can fill out with your query. This option is useful for non-urgent matters, as you might not receive an immediate response. However, it allows you to provide detailed information about your issue, which can help the support team address your concerns more effectively.

4. Third-Party Directories
There are numerous online directories that list contact information for businesses. While these can be helpful, always verify the information with the official Reliance Finance website to ensure it's accurate and up-to-date. Numbers can change, and you don't want to waste your time calling an old or incorrect number.
When using third-party directories, it's important to exercise caution and verify the information provided. Not all directories are created equal, and some may contain outdated or inaccurate contact details. Before relying on a directory listing, take a moment to cross-reference the information with the official Reliance Finance website or other reliable sources. This will help you avoid potential frustration and ensure that you're reaching the correct department.
In addition to verifying the accuracy of the contact information, it's also important to be aware of potential scams or fraudulent listings. Some unscrupulous individuals may create fake directory listings in an attempt to collect personal information or trick unsuspecting users. Be wary of any listings that seem suspicious or too good to be true, and never provide sensitive information unless you're absolutely certain that you're dealing with a legitimate source. By taking these precautions, you can protect yourself from potential scams and ensure that you're getting accurate and reliable contact information.
